How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Sabillasville?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Sabillasville 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,732 | $925 | $2,475 |
| Sabillasville 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,882 | $1,099 | $2,898 |
Sabillasville 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,066 | $1,299 | $4,160 |
| Sabillasville 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,383 | $1,950 | $3,381 |
